RAF Langham opened in 1940 as an all grass satellite to Bircham Newton, it closed in 1942 to be redeveloped with concrete runways. During the war it operated in a variety of roles including, target towing, army co-operation, coastal patrol and anti-shipping. Flying ceased in 1958, the airfield is now home to the ubiquitous turkey sheds.
Another of Langhams claims to fame is it’s Dome Trainer, one of the few remaining.
